Gwen's father, the police captain, finally captures the Spider-Woman only to discover it's his own daughter. Gwen makes a difficult choice to leave her universe with Miguel O'Hara.

Miles Morales returns for the next chapter of the Oscar®-winning Spider-Verse saga, Spider-Man™: Across the Spider-Verse (2018, Best Animated Film, Spider-Man™: Into The Spider-Verse). After reuniting with Gwen Stacy, Brooklyn’s full-time, friendly neighborhood Spider-Man is catapulted across the Multiverse, where he encounters the Spider Society, a team of Spider-People charged with protecting the Multiverse’s very existence. But when the heroes clash on how to handle a new threat, Miles finds himself pitted against the other Spiders and must set out on his own to save those he loves most.
